Build Provenance: Deploybeacon Chat Bot

Quick orientation for new contractors. Deploybeacon is our chat bot that announces deploy status to team channels. Every bot release is built in the Ferrowick pipeline, which attaches a provenance record linking the binary to its source revision and builder. Before pushing a new version, confirm the record validates cleanly. The current verified build token follows below.

pipeline stamp: htk31_f769b577b3028a4e9958e5bb8d1259a

## Runbook: Routeglint Driver Assignment

The heuristic service scores drivers every 90 seconds and writes assignments to the dispatch ledger. All writes are parameterized; the service account has no DDL rights. For your review, note that scoring inputs are cached in-memory only and never logged. Audit queries should run against the read replica. The replica is reached via the connection string below.

replica DSN, kajep-yahag: mssql://praok_svc:iF@db-8d68.plorvaio.local:5432/eliion

# Break-Glass: Catalog Cache Invalidation

Scope: the Pinrow product catalog at Veldstone Retail. If stale prices persist after a purge and the Hollowmere invalidation queue is wedged, use break-glass to flush the edge tier directly. Contractors: get verbal sign-off from the catalog lead first. Steps: open the Hollowmere admin shell, select emergency-flush, confirm the tenant, and run it once — repeated flushes thrash the origin. Access is logged and expires after 20 minutes. Unseal the admin shell with the passphrase below.

recovery phrase for kahop-tajog: istix-casvan

# Break-Glass: Healthcheck Overrides (Vanthor LB)

Use only when the Pilastro load balancer is flapping healthy nodes. Break-glass lets you pin backends and bypass the `/livez` probe for 30 minutes. All actions are logged and auto-revert. Steps: open the override console, pin the known-good pool, silence the probe alerts, file an incident note. The console unlock requires the break-glass recovery passphrase, recorded below for on-call use.

recovery phrase for bawef-kagug: casix-tamvan-lamath-holeth-gilmir-drudor-julax-wenok-wenael-rusvan-holax-goriel-frawyn